RS 26:714: Soliciting sale of alcoholic beverages in prohibition area; penalty

A. No person shall seek, solicit, or receive orders from anyone for the purchase of alcoholic beverages within the limits of any municipality, ward, or parish in which the retailing of such beverages is prohibited.
B. Whoever violates this Section shall be fined not more than one hundred dollars or imprisoned for not more than six months, or both.
